						Re: Vyv - my series 3
The night shot was taken by a friend of mine, 30 second exposure, and wander around the car with a light source...
I'll get the stickers done to the correct size to fit properly onto the filter housing...it won't be the same as the original one, but as it will fit better I think it will look better.
Not sure what blue it is, but it was leftover from an MX5, so it's a Mazda colour...I'll have a look at the tin next time I'm over at the workshop and let you know. It's a bit darker than the original, which works better with the tender blue ish paint on the bodywork in my humble opinion
I'd like to keep it 12A if I can, especially as I have the elford to go on. I guess I'll strip this one down and see what the housings and rotors are like, and go from there. Not something I'll enjoy doing, nor is it anything I've done before, I'm a rebuild newbie
